Ticket: Sealed vault blocking Parcelgram webhook redeploy

The secrets vault holding the parcel-tracking webhook's signing material sealed itself after last night's storage failover and now rejects all reads. Redeploys of the webhook service fail at secret fetch. Documenting the fix for future maintainers: run the unseal utility from the ops bastion, confirm the vault ID, and when prompted, supply the recovery passphrase recorded directly below.

unlock words, hahip-baduf: holwyn-istath-julvan

Quick update: the Larkspur migration has slipped again, this time by roughly six weeks. The vendor underestimated the data-cleansing effort, and our own testing team has been stretched thin covering the Quillden rollout. We're reshuffling resources and pausing non-critical change requests until Larkspur stabilises. Please hold off promising go-live dates to your teams. I know this is frustrating — it is for us too. The strategic reasoning behind these priorities is summarised in the note below.

board note of tadup-tajog: Headcount on the Oliiel team goes from 31 to 88 by the end of February. Gross margin on Oliiel came in at 62 percent against a plan of 29 percent.

Welcome to the Crashwatch side of things! When the Pebblefin app crashes, reports flow through our Tumblepike pipeline and land in the triage queue within about five minutes. Support folks mostly just read the dashboards, but if you ever need to re-upload a symbol file for a stuck report, the uploader will ask you to sign the bundle. Use the key below.

deploy key for kahof-tadup: bky4_rRMZ